Read the Education Committee’s 2010 Policy Positions here:

  • Protect spending and resources to Special Education and integration programs designed to help ESL students.
  • Enforce the policy that the children who are admitted to public charter schools should closely reflect the demographics of the areas in which they serve.
  • Maintain the extra instruction assistance currently making gains in underachieving schools by continuing to properly fund afterschool and Saturday sessions.
  • Establish art education as part of a well-rounded education by embedding it as part of all areas of the curriculum in grades K-12 public schools.
  • Secure funding assurances that will allow community and four year public colleges to grow and move towards making higher education a reality for all students. This will result in a more competitive workforce and stronger state economy.
